Salty is Seawater is the last stage in Swimming Cats. THE SLOTH is introduced in this stage.

Strategies

Strategy 1

Units:

  • Giraffe Cat
  • Wall Cat
  • Dragon Cat
  • Any Meatshields
  • Valkyrie Cat

At the beginning of the level, spam Giraffe Cat. This will stop THE SLOTH for a bit. Repeatedly spam Wall Cat and when the player has enough money for Dragon Cat, spam it and continue spamming Wall Cat. Keep doing this on and on and on until player sees Celeboodle and the Doge Dark. They both give about 1500 money when killed. Then spam Macho Cat, Brave Cat, Giraffe Cat and Sexy Legs Cat. Only spawn Valkyrie Cat if the player's defense isn't good enough. You don't want 3000 cents to be wasted. It takes 3 knockbacks to defeat THE SLOTH. After THE SLOTH gets defeated, spam everything you've got and win the level.

Strategy 2 (Speedrun)

  • Lineup: Butterfly Cat (should be able to withstand at least 2 hits from THE SLOTH), Face Cat (optional), Angry Delinquent Cat (should be able to withstand at least 2 hits from THE SLOTH)
  • Power Ups: Sniper Cat
  • When the battle starts, spam Butterfly Cats and Face Cats. After a while, start spamming Angry Delinquent Cats. After 50 (less or more) seconds, THE SLOTH should be dead.

Strategy 3 (Paris Cat spam)

This stage is pretty easy, after all being one of the first sol stages. The strategy is to basically spam Paris Cats (Cyborg Cat), and fast meatshields such as Crazed Cat to stall THE SLOTH. You don’t need to worry about Celeboodle or any peons because Paris can kill them. Recommend to use Bahamut for massive damage dealing and to make the battle quicker.
